Description of problem:
when you create hostgroup with html tags, UI appends the closing tag and string in name and covert it to a link.

ex: create hostgroup with name <h1>test</h1> and after creation UI will list it as  <h1>test</<h1>test</h1> and covert 

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
sat6 GA snap5

How reproducible:
always 

Steps to Reproduce:
1. create hostgroup with name <h1>test</h1>
2. once created, see the listing
3.

Actual results:
UI shows <h1>test</<h1>test</h1> on creating hostgroup with name  <h1>test</h1>

see the string "test" and closing tag"</h1>" appended to the original name.

Expected results:
UI should the given name <h1>test</h1> in listing too and without converted it into a link
